商城小程序的设计阶段包括哪些内容?

更新时间:2024-07-03 17:30:35

商城小程序的设计阶段是开发过程中至关重要的一环,它涵盖了多个关键任务和输出,确保最终产品能够满足用户需求并具备良好的用户体验。以下是设计阶段的主要内容及其任务和输出:

1. 需求分析与调研
在设计阶段的最初阶段,团队需要进行全面的需求分析和市场调研。这包括:
&8211; 用户需求分析: 确定目标用户群体、其行为习惯、偏好和需求。
&8211; 竞品分析: 分析竞争对手的小程序,了解其优势和不足。
&8211; 功能需求定义: 确定小程序的核心功能和特色功能,以及必要的技术实现方案。

输出: 需求文档、用户画像、竞品分析报告、功能列表和优先级排列。

2. 信息架构设计
在需求分析的基础上,进行信息架构设计,包括:
&8211; 页面结构设计: 设计小程序的整体页面结构和页面间的导航关系。
&8211; 内容组织: 确定各页面的内容分类和组织方式,保证信息的清晰性和易访问性。
&8211; 交互设计: 设计用户与小程序之间的交互流程,包括各种可能的用户操作路径和反馈机制。

输出: 网站地图、信息架构图、交互流程图、初步的页面布局设计。

3. 视觉设计
在信息架构确定后,进行视觉设计阶段:
&8211; 界面风格设计: 根据品牌定位和用户喜好,设计小程序的整体视觉风格,包括色彩、字体、图标等。
&8211; 界面元素设计: 设计各个页面的具体界面元素,如按钮、表单、图片等。
&8211; 视觉稿设计: 制作高保真的界面设计稿,展示每个页面的最终外观和布局。

输出: 视觉设计稿、界面元素库、品牌风格指南。

4. 技术架构设计
与视觉设计同时进行的是技术架构设计:
&8211; 前端技术选型: 确定使用的前端开发技术和框架,如Vue.js、React等。
&8211; 后端服务选择: 需要的后端服务和数据库选型,确保系统的稳定性和扩展性。
&8211; 安全与性能考虑: 设计安全策略,优化性能,确保小程序在各种环境下都能正常运行和响应。

输出: 技术架构设计文档、前后端接口定义、数据库设计文档。

5. 原型设计与验证
在所有设计方面完成后,制作小程序的交互原型:
&8211; 低保真原型: 初步的交互设计和页面布局,用于快速验证用户操作流程。
&8211; 高保真原型: 将视觉设计与交互设计结合,制作高保真的交互原型,模拟真实用户体验。

输出: 原型演示、用户反馈报告、最终确认的交互设计稿。

6. 用户测试与优化
进行用户测试,收集用户反馈并进行相应优化:
&8211; 功能测试: 确保所有功能按预期运行,修复潜在的bug。
&8211; 用户体验测试: 邀请真实用户参与测试,评估用户体验和界面易用性。
&8211; 性能测试: 测试小程序的加载速度、稳定性和安全性。

输出: 测试报告、优化建议、最终的修正版原型和设计稿。

7. 最终交付与上线准备
完成所有设计和优化后,准备小程序的最终交付和上线:
&8211; 文档整理: 归档所有设计文档、测试报告和优化记录。
&8211; 部署准备: 配置服务器、域名和数据库等基础设施,准备发布环境。
&8211; 上线前检查: 进行最后的功能和安全检查,确保小程序准备就绪。

输出: 最终的设计文档、部署计划、上线审批。

综上所述,商城小程序的设计阶段不仅仅是视觉设计,还涉及到深入的用户研究、技术选型和系统架构设计,通过系统化的流程和输出,确保最终的小程序能够满足用户的需求并达到商业目标。